Searched refs:getNumVirtRegs (Results 1 – 24 of 24) sorted by relevance
/external/llvm/lib/CodeGen/ |
D | VirtRegMap.cpp | 71 unsigned NumRegs = MF->getRegInfo().getNumVirtRegs(); in grow() 122 for (unsigned i = 0, e = MRI->getNumVirtRegs(); i != e; ++i) { in print() 131 for (unsigned i = 0, e = MRI->getNumVirtRegs(); i != e; ++i) { in print() 287 for (unsigned Idx = 0, IdxE = MRI->getNumVirtRegs(); Idx != IdxE; ++Idx) { in addMBBLiveIns()
|
D | MachineRegisterInfo.cpp | 97 unsigned Reg = TargetRegisterInfo::index2VirtReg(getNumVirtRegs()); in createVirtualRegister() 109 for (unsigned i = 0, e = getNumVirtRegs(); i != e; ++i) { in clearVirtRegs() 162 for (unsigned i = 0, e = getNumVirtRegs(); i != e; ++i) in verifyUseLists()
|
D | RegAllocBase.cpp | 74 for (unsigned i = 0, e = MRI->getNumVirtRegs(); i != e; ++i) { in seedLiveRegs()
|
D | CalcSpillWeights.cpp | 37 for (unsigned i = 0, e = MRI.getNumVirtRegs(); i != e; ++i) { in calculateSpillWeightsAndHints()
|
D | RegAllocGreedy.cpp | 215 ExtraRegInfo.resize(MRI->getNumVirtRegs()); in setStage() 221 ExtraRegInfo.resize(MRI->getNumVirtRegs()); in setStage() 1303 ExtraRegInfo.resize(MRI->getNumVirtRegs()); in splitAroundRegion() 1527 ExtraRegInfo.resize(MRI->getNumVirtRegs()); in tryBlockSplit() 1619 ExtraRegInfo.resize(MRI->getNumVirtRegs()); in tryInstructionSplit() 2596 ExtraRegInfo.resize(MRI->getNumVirtRegs()); in runOnMachineFunction()
|
D | LiveIntervalAnalysis.cpp | 137 VirtRegIntervals.resize(MRI->getNumVirtRegs()); in runOnMachineFunction() 163 for (unsigned i = 0, e = MRI->getNumVirtRegs(); i != e; ++i) { in print() 213 for (unsigned i = 0, e = MRI->getNumVirtRegs(); i != e; ++i) { in computeVirtRegs() 676 for (unsigned i = 0, e = MRI->getNumVirtRegs(); i != e; ++i) { in addKillFlags()
|
D | RegisterPressure.cpp | 165 unsigned NumVirtRegs = MRI.getNumVirtRegs(); in init() 228 UntiedDefs.setUniverse(MRI->getNumVirtRegs()); in init()
|
D | RegAllocFast.cpp | 1087 StackSlotForVirtReg.resize(MRI->getNumVirtRegs()); in runOnMachineFunction() 1088 LiveVirtRegs.setUniverse(MRI->getNumVirtRegs()); in runOnMachineFunction()
|
D | LiveVariables.cpp | 796 for (unsigned i = 0, e = MRI->getNumVirtRegs(); i != e; ++i) { in addNewBlock()
|
D | MachineVerifier.cpp | 1376 for (unsigned i = 0, e = MRI->getNumVirtRegs(); i != e; ++i) { in verifyLiveVariables() 1402 for (unsigned i = 0, e = MRI->getNumVirtRegs(); i != e; ++i) { in verifyLiveIntervals()
|
D | RegAllocPBQP.cpp | 528 for (unsigned I = 0, E = MRI.getNumVirtRegs(); I != E; ++I) { in findVRegIntervalsToAlloc()
|
D | PrologEpilogInserter.cpp | 171 assert(!Fn.getRegInfo().getNumVirtRegs() && "Regalloc must assign all vregs"); in runOnMachineFunction()
|
D | MIRPrinter.cpp | 205 for (unsigned I = 0, E = RegInfo.getNumVirtRegs(); I < E; ++I) { in convert()
|
D | MachineBasicBlock.cpp | 920 for (unsigned i = 0, e = MRI->getNumVirtRegs(); i != e; ++i) { in SplitCriticalEdge()
|
D | ScheduleDAGInstrs.cpp | 870 unsigned NumVirtRegs = MRI.getNumVirtRegs(); in buildSchedGraph()
|
/external/llvm/lib/Target/WebAssembly/ |
D | WebAssemblyMachineFunctionInfo.cpp | 24 WARegs.resize(MF.getRegInfo().getNumVirtRegs(), Reg); in initWARegs()
|
D | WebAssemblyRegNumbering.cpp | 87 unsigned NumVRegs = MF.getRegInfo().getNumVirtRegs(); in runOnMachineFunction()
|
D | WebAssemblyRegColoring.cpp | 93 unsigned NumVRegs = MRI->getNumVirtRegs(); in runOnMachineFunction()
|
D | WebAssemblyAsmPrinter.cpp | 172 for (unsigned Idx = 0, IdxE = MRI->getNumVirtRegs(); Idx != IdxE; ++Idx) { in EmitFunctionBodyStart()
|
/external/llvm/include/llvm/CodeGen/ |
D | MachineRegisterInfo.h | 592 unsigned getNumVirtRegs() const { return VRegInfo.size(); } in getNumVirtRegs() function
|
/external/llvm/lib/Target/Hexagon/ |
D | HexagonSplitDouble.cpp | 215 unsigned NumRegs = MRI->getNumVirtRegs(); in partitionRegisters()
|
/external/llvm/lib/Target/NVPTX/ |
D | NVPTXAsmPrinter.cpp | 1641 unsigned int numVRs = MRI->getNumVirtRegs(); in setAndEmitFunctionVirtualRegisters()
|
/external/llvm/lib/Target/PowerPC/ |
D | PPCISelDAGToDAG.cpp | 257 for (unsigned i = 0, e = RegInfo->getNumVirtRegs(); i != e; ++i) { in InsertVRSaveCode()
|
/external/llvm/docs/ |
D | CodeGenerator.rst | 1272 for (unsigned i = 0, e = MRI->getNumVirtRegs(); i != e; ++i) {
|